Transaction

85abd0ab04ceb43e96037197f1ecdbb9ef41b966cb39cff0baf3aec358244235

Summary

In Block228819
TimeFri, 16 Jun 2023 04:31:00 UTC
Total Input2232.04857672 Nebula
Total Output2287.04857672 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
738763 Confirmations2287.04857672 Nebula
Raw Transaction